Build can embed the wrong runtime after switching Pulley feature #545

Summary

Switching between native and Pulley builds can embed the wrong hyperlight-wasm-runtime guest. A native host build can retain the Pulley runtime and reject a valid x86 AOT component:

GuestError(GuestError, "Module was compiled for architecture 'x86_64'")

Reproduction

Use a consumer feature that enables hyperlight-wasm/pulley.

  1. Build and run with an x86 AOT component.
  2. Build and run with the Pulley feature and a Pulley AOT component.
  3. Build and run with the x86 AOT component again.

The third run can reject the x86 component. This reproduces with hyperlight-wasm 0.15.0 and Wasmtime 36.0.14.

Root cause

hyperlight-wasm/build.rs builds the embedded runtime into a shared nested target directory:

<target>/hyperlight-wasm-runtime/x86_64-hyperlight-none/<profile>/hyperlight-wasm-runtime

Native and Pulley Cargo units have separate OUT_DIR directories. Both generated wasm_runtime_resource.rs files use include_bytes! with this shared mutable path.

The nested Pulley build overwrites the runtime binary. Cargo can rebuild the native hyperlight-wasm unit because the include_bytes! input changed while its build script remains cached. The native unit then embeds the Pulley binary.

The shared output also permits a race between concurrent normal and Pulley builds.

Suggested fix

Copy the completed nested runtime into the outer build script's OUT_DIR. Point include_bytes! at that private copy. This preserves the shared nested compilation cache.

Concurrent builds also need one of these protections:

  • Hold a lock across the nested build and copy.
  • Use a separate nested target directory for each runtime configuration.

The configuration key must cover pulley, gdb, trace_guest, wasmtime_latest, and the WIT environment values. The outer OUT_DIR provides complete isolation but duplicates compilation work.

Regression coverage

Build a consumer in both sequences. Verify that the final component loads:

normal -> pulley -> normal
pulley -> normal -> pulley

Concurrent native and Pulley builds should produce correctly matched embedded runtimes.
